Post-Earthquake Damage Assessment: Field Observations and Recent Developments with Recommendations from the Kahramanmaraş Earthquakes in Türkiye on February 6th, 2023 (Pazarcık M7.8 and Elbistan M7.6)
This study investigates the effects of the February 6, 2023, earthquakes in Türkiye, measuring 7.8 and 7.6 magnitudes (Mercalli intensities XI and X). It comprehensively assesses their impact, alon...

期刊介绍: The Journal of Earthquake Engineering is a publication of peer-reviewed papers on research and development in analytical, experimental and field studies of earthquakes from an engineering seismology as well as a structural engineering viewpoint. The Journal combines the three most important ingredients for a successful technical publication; the highest possible technical quality, speed of publication and competitive subscription rates. The journal draws on research and development work from engineering communities worldwide in the fields of earthquake engineering and engineering seismology. Work on experimental, analytical, design, and field studies will be considered for publication. The following is a nonexhaustive list of topics considered to be within the scope of the journal: -Historical seismicity -Tectonics and seismology -Strong-motion studies -Soil dynamics and foundations -Site effects and geotechnical aspects -Dynamic soil-structure interaction -Foundation design for earthquake loading -Seismic response of buildings -Seismic response of bridges and other special structures -Lifelines earthquake engineering -Passive and active systems for earthquake protection -Repair and strengthening -Earthquake disaster mitigation and emergency planning -Case histories and field studies -Seismic sea-waves (Tsunamis)
